Los Angeles sees 4 downtown office skyscrapers in distress with billions in defaulted loans, bids expected far below debt balances. Manufacturing & CRE Construction spend peaked over a year ago

“4 distressed office buildings in Los Angeles, California. Brookfield and its lenders (and receivers and special servicers) are peddling four active offerings that total about 4.9M SF of Class A office space in the Financial District, roughly 18% of the total inventory. EY Plaza: Colliers is marketing the $275M, non-preforming note tied to the property …

December 2024 Rental Report: Rents Continue To Fall as New Construction Outpaces Demand

December 2024 marks the seventeenth consecutive month of year-over-year rent decline for 0-2 bedroom properties in the 50 largest metropolitan areas of the US. Rents nationally were down by 1.1% from December 2023. The national median asking rent fell to $1,695, dipping below $1,700 for the first time since April 2022. Median rent fell consistently …
